The document is a specification guide detailing the availability, sourcing options, and pricing considerations for Grade 65 wide flange steel products, primarily comparing offerings from SDI and Nucor. It outlines which grades are available, who manufactures them, potential pricing advantages, and notes differences in size availability between the two suppliers.

The M.E.M.O. summarizes the availability and suitability of various bolt finishes and grades, including black/plain, hot dipped galvanized, mechanically galvanized, and GEOMET® zinc flake coating. It highlights which bolt types are commonly available with each finish, notes limitations like hydrogen embrittlement risks, and emphasizes the corrosion protection benefits of GEOMET coating.

The presentation introduces SidePlate, a structural design approach that enhances building connections between engineers and fabricators by optimizing moment frame connections for efficiency, cost savings, and structural performance. It highlights the benefits of SidePlate’s all-bolted connections, its application across various project types, and its ability to reduce steel tonnage, construction time, and costs while improving safety and flexibility.
